The fight for special category status between Bihar and Andhra Pradesh has been a contentious issue in Indian politics. Both states have been pushing for this status, which would entitle them to special financial assistance from the central government. Bihar has been arguing that it deserves special category status due to its high poverty levels, low per capita income, and lack of industrial development. Andhra Pradesh, on the other hand, has been making the case that it needs special assistance due to the economic disruption caused by the bifurcation of the state in 2014.

The special category status was initially introduced by the National Development Council in 1969 to provide special assistance to states that were disadvantaged in terms of location, infrastructure, and resources. States with this status receive a higher share of central funds and have access to various tax incentives. These states are also entitled to assistance in meeting the additional costs incurred for development projects. Currently, 11 states including Himachal Pradesh, Jammu and Kashmir, and the northeastern states have been granted special category status.

The debate over special category status for Bihar and Andhra Pradesh has been ongoing for several years. Both states have argued that they meet the criteria for this status based on their economic indicators and development needs. Bihar, which is still one of the poorest states in India, has been facing challenges in reducing poverty levels and improving infrastructure. The state government believes that special category status would provide the necessary resources to accelerate its development and address the socio-economic disparities.

On the other hand, Andhra Pradesh has been grappling with the aftermath of the bifurcation in 2014, which resulted in the creation of Telangana as a separate state. The division of assets and resources has had a significant impact on the economic growth of Andhra Pradesh, leading to demands for special assistance from the central government. The state government has argued that it needs additional financial support to overcome the challenges posed by the bifurcation and to fund key infrastructure projects such as the construction of a new capital city.

The central government, led by Prime Minister Narendra Modi, has been facing pressure from both Bihar and Andhra Pradesh to grant them special category status. However, the government has been hesitant to make such a commitment, citing concerns about the financial implications and the need to review the existing criteria for special category status. Some experts have also raised questions about the effectiveness of this status in promoting balanced regional development and have called for a more holistic approach to addressing the needs of disadvantaged states.
